#4fcede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4fcede is composed of 31% red, 80.8%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.4% cyan, 7.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 186.7 degrees, a saturation of 68.4% and a lightness of 59%. #4fcede color hex could be obtained by blending #9effff with #009dbd.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#4fcede
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010506 is the darkest color, while #f4fc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fcede
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f9c9e is the less saturated color, while #2fe7fe is the most saturated one.
